    <thetext>toURLRef() in WKSharedAPICast.h should return null for a null string.

Looks like it&apos;s just missing a &quot;return&quot; here:

    if (!string)
        ProxyingRefPtr&lt;WebURL&gt;(0);</thetext>

    <thetext>(In reply to comment #3)
&gt; What&apos;s the user-visible or developer-visible effect of this bug? In general I think it&apos;s a lot more useful to have bugs describe symptoms rather than describing changes we&apos;d like to make to the code.

If WKURLCopyCFURL() is called on the resulting WKURLRef later, it&apos;ll assert in
ASSERT(!toImpl(URLRef)-&gt;string().isNull());
because the string is null.
